## 2.8.0 — Compaction defaults changed

Heads up for reviewers: Pondermill's log compaction now kicks in way more aggressively by default. We shrank the dirty ratio threshold and shortened the min-retention window after the disk scare last quarter. Most deployments won't notice anything except smaller partitions. Existing overrides still win. The new defaults shipping with this release are as follows.

settings of fafog-haduf:
ZORIX_PIN=4648
ZORIX_METRICS_HOST=metrics.zorix.paliqsys.corp
ZORIX_LOG_LEVEL=info
ZORIX_TENANT=druix

Welcome aboard! We're migrating the old Fenwick cron jobs into Loomwork, our workflow engine, and CI keeps failing on the schedule-parity check. Usually it's a timezone mismatch — the crons assumed server-local time, Loomwork wants UTC. Fix the schedule annotations and rerun. The failing pipeline run is identified by the token below.

trace token, fafog-kageg: htk4_98e6

- [ ] Double-check the relevance tuning notes for Quillsearch before we ship. Marisol bumped the title-match boost from 1.4 to 2.1 and nerfed the synonym expansion on the Fennwick catalog, so recall dips slightly but precision looks way better in the eval set. If the offline metrics match what's in the notes doc, tick this off. The tuning run is tagged with the token below.

build token for kagaf-hahof: htk14_9d3d4d26d7d8de